Defining Chain Wire Fencing Supplies

Chain wire fencing supplies encompass all the components required to construct a chain wire fence. This includes the chain wire fabric itself, which is the interwoven steel mesh; posts, which provide the structural support; rails or top rails, which run horizontally along the posts to secure the fabric; tension bands and braces, used to tighten and stabilize the fence; and various fittings such as caps, sleeves, and tie wires. Different gauges of wire, mesh sizes, and coating types affect the overall strength, security, and lifespan of the fence.

Core Components of Chain Wire Fencing

The essential components of chain wire fencing are the fabric, posts, and tensioning system. The fabric, woven from galvanized or PVC-coated steel wire, determines the fence’s strength and security level. Post materials commonly include steel, aluminum, and wood, each offering different levels of durability and cost. The type of post chosen significantly impacts the overall stability and longevity of the fence.

Tensioning systems, comprising tension bands, braces, and tension wire, are crucial for maintaining the proper tension in the fabric. Correct tension is vital for preventing sagging, ensuring security, and prolonging the fence’s lifespan. Different tensioning methods exist, ranging from traditional hand-tightening to more sophisticated mechanical systems. These components work synergistically to deliver a robust and reliable fencing solution.

Furthermore, accessories like caps, sleeves, and tie wires play a supporting role in completing the fence installation. Caps prevent water accumulation in posts, reducing corrosion, while sleeves provide a smooth and secure connection between posts and rails. Tie wires securely fasten the fabric to the posts, ensuring the fence remains intact. Properly selected and installed components contribute to the overall integrity of the chain wire fencing system.

Challenges and Solutions

A common challenge associated with chain wire fencing is potential for sagging or stretching over time, especially in areas with fluctuating temperatures or heavy loads. This can compromise the fence's security and aesthetic appeal.

The solution lies in proper installation techniques, including ensuring adequate tensioning, using high-quality posts and fittings, and selecting appropriate wire gauge and mesh size for the specific application. FAQS

What is the typical lifespan of a properly installed chain wire fence?

A well-maintained chain wire fence, especially one using high-quality galvanized or PVC-coated wire and sturdy posts, can easily last 20-30 years or even longer. Factors like climate, soil conditions, and maintenance frequency significantly influence longevity. Regular inspections and prompt repairs are essential to maximize the lifespan of the fence.

How does PVC coating affect the durability of chain wire?

PVC coating provides an extra layer of protection against corrosion, UV damage, and abrasion, significantly extending the life of the chain wire. It helps prevent rust and maintains the fence's appearance over time. While more expensive than galvanization alone, the added durability makes PVC coating a worthwhile investment, especially in harsh environments.

What is the recommended post spacing for chain wire fencing?

The standard post spacing for chain wire fencing is typically 8 to 10 feet, depending on the height of the fence and the terrain. Closer spacing is recommended for taller fences and areas prone to strong winds. Proper post spacing ensures adequate support and prevents sagging of the chain wire fabric. Always consult with a fencing professional to determine the optimal spacing for your specific needs.

How can I prevent sagging in my chain wire fence?

Preventing sagging involves proper installation with sufficient tension, sturdy posts, and appropriate spacing. Regularly inspect the fence for any signs of looseness and re-tension the wire as needed. Using high-quality tension bands and braces is crucial. Ensure the posts are set deep enough in the ground to provide adequate support.

Is chain wire fencing a suitable option for high-security applications?

While standard chain wire offers good security, for high-security applications, consider using heavier gauge wire, smaller mesh sizes, and tamper-resistant fittings. Adding security features like top rails with anti-climb extensions or barbed wire can further enhance security. Professional installation and regular inspections are also critical for maintaining a secure perimeter.

What maintenance is required for a chain wire fence?

Regular maintenance includes inspecting for damage, such as broken wires or loose fittings, and making prompt repairs. Re-tensioning the wire as needed is essential to prevent sagging. Cleaning the fence periodically to remove dirt and debris helps maintain its appearance and prolong its lifespan. Periodic applications of rust inhibitors can also protect galvanized surfaces.
